The FD-258 is the FBI’s standard fingerprint card used for civil background checks, licensing, and identity verification.

 Common Uses 

Federal employment & security clearances

ATF/NFA firearm licensing

FINRA & financial industry background checks

Medical, legal, and education licensing

Immigration and visa applications

Out-of-state professional licensing

 Our Process 

  1. We come to you: Ink fingerprinting requires an in-person appointment.

  2. Verify ID: We confirm your identity using government-issued photo ID.

  3. Prepare the Card: We use official FD-258 cards and black ink, per FBI standards.

  4. Capture Prints: Each finger is rolled and pressed for clarity and completeness.

  5. Review & Sign: You sign the card in front of our technician; we sign and date it.

  6. Submission Guidance: We provide instructions for mailing or submitting your card.​
